我在WordPress中创建了一个页面。这是我的页面网址
www.example.com/test
当我点击此URL时, 它的工作正常。该页面的某些链接没有这样的页面。
www.example.com/test/calculate
当我点击该URL时, 它会显示404。我知道此页面不存在, 而且我也不想创建它。我也不想编辑404模板来显示。我希望该自定义页面看起来真实。
那么如何实现呢?
#1你可以使用带有RewriteRule的.htaccess来实现。例子:
RewriteRule /test/(.*) /test/
但这取决于你要将URL内部重定向到的位置。
#2404页面是错误页面, 当你的网站中找不到任何内容时调用。
1))对于404页面的编辑, 某些主题为此提供了选项。因此, 首先检查你的主题选项是否与404页面相关?
2))你也可以使用此插件自定义$ 404页面:404页面插件
3))要编辑主题的404错误模板文件, 请执行以下操作:
- -打开WordPress管理面板:
- -选择外观菜单。
- -选择主题编辑器页面。
- -检查主题是否在文件列表中包含” 404模板” 。
- -点击页面右侧的” 404模板” 链接。
- -编辑消息文本以说出你想说的话。
- -保存你的更改。
<
?php get_header();
?>
<
div id="content">
<
h2>
Error 404 - Not Found<
/h2>
<
/div>
<
?php get_sidebar();
?>
<
?php get_footer();
?>
推荐阅读
- 如何在Genesis子主题中创建自定义帖子模板
- 如何将WordPress主题转换为AMP Ready主题()
- 如何控制Visual Composer插件全宽部分的宽度
- 如何在一个WordPress主题中连接多个HTML页面()
- 当我们将网站链接发送给任何人时,如何在WordPress中更改网站图像
- 如何在Hestia Pro WordPress主题中更改商店背景颜色()
- SD卡分区时需要注意什么(SD卡分区注意事项)
- go build命令参数详解
- 一些windows批处理脚本